Output 3081159ccc0ad46b600428275e63ea85ca32b3c5b2cb904118342a53c5fba16e:116

value
145331
script pubkey
OP_0 OP_PUSHBYTES_20 f3d7c7838ab4707dcfd84d6252f44b0e90437b0f
address
bc1q70tu0qu2k3c8mn7cf4399aztp6gyx7c0umztsd
transaction
3081159ccc0ad46b600428275e63ea85ca32b3c5b2cb904118342a53c5fba16e